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720810 2732326 1930 89555878 907014565
986404 6430968248 0143
986404 6430968248 0143
99 8752056392 134
All about undefined
Interested in learning more?
986404 6430968248 0143
99 8752056392 134
See more
34910761443 60092689
2804 14279 291140332
See more
02669 18403
05945435 90803018833 571 38125 969
See more